超音波感應器方塊 | 樂高機器人EV3使用說明
超音波感應器方塊
![]() |
超音波感應器方塊從超音波感應器獲取資料。可以測量距離(以英寸或厘米爲單位)並獲取數字輸出。還可以將距離與預設值進行比較以獲取邏輯(“是”或“否”)輸出。還可以在“僅偵聽”模式中檢測其他超音波信號。 有關超音波感應器的作用、它提供的資料以及程式範例的更多資訊,請參考使用超音波感應器幫助。 |
提示和技巧
在“測量 - 距離 - 厘米”和“測量 - 距離 - 英寸”模式中,感應器始終發送連續超音波信號。
可用於超音波感應器方塊的輸入取決於所選模式。可以將輸入值直接輸入到方塊中。或者,可以通過資料線從其他程式方塊的輸出提供輸入值。
輸入 | 類型 | 允許的值 | 備註 |
---|---|---|---|
比較類型 | 數字 | 0 - 5 | 0:=(等於) 1:≠(不等於) 2:>(大於) 3:≥(大於或等於) 4:<(小於) 5:≤(小於或等於) |
預設值 | 數字 | 任何數字 | 要將感應器資料與之進行比較的值 |
測量模式 | 數字 | 0 或 1 | “高級”模式中的超音波信號模式: 0 = 脈沖 1 = 連續 |
可用輸出取決於所選模式。要使用某個輸出,請使用資料線將該輸出連接到另一個程式方塊。
輸出 | 類型 | 備註 |
---|---|---|
距離(厘米) | 數字 | 以厘米爲單位的距離(0-255 厘米)。 |
距離(英寸) | 數字 | 以英寸爲單位的距離(0-100 英寸)。 |
檢測到超音波 | 邏輯 | 如果檢測到超音波信號,則爲“是”,否則爲“否”。 |
比較結果 | 邏輯 | 比較模式的“是/否”結果。 |
快速連結